    I haven't installed 47 yet. Have a look here for possible issues with 46 if previously installed.

    [Released] Cyberfox 47.0 - 8pecxstudios Support Forums

    Note: 47 is a major update. Personally I've experienced problems with major updates in the past including Firefox.

    My preference. Turn off auto updates and check manually for new versions. Download the installer fro any new version and install straight over the top of the old version (after backing up profile)

    If there are any issues do a clean install (option is available when running installer) and restore bookmarks and extensions from backed up profile.

    Thanks for the tips.

    I tried again to update, but this time installing a clean version of the 47.
    However the same error appeared.
    So I repeated the procedure to paste the backup into the program folder and 46 started without problems.

    This is what the error menu showed
    The first sentence means undefined entity?


    XML-parsefout: ongedefinieerde entiteit
    Locatie: chrome://browser/content/browser.xul
    Regelnummer 480, kolom 6: <menuitem id="context_CopyCurrentTabUrl"


    ------------^

    The problem is the incompatibilty of the Dutch languagepack or packs between the 46 and 47 version.
    The default language English should be set, the Dutch languagepack removed.
    Than update to 47 and install the languagepack from https://cyberfox.8pecxstudios.com/
    The language manager tried to install from the 46 version.
    After updating to 47 again installed the languagemanager.
    Downloaded the right package and yes 47 started.
    Now I'm curious if the browser finally will be allowed to change the default language to Dutch?
    Crossed fingers. Glad I made a backup.

    What do you mean by "Paste backup into program folder?"

    Backups should be restored to:

    C:\Users\USERNAME\AppData\Roaming\8pecxstudios\Cyberfox\Profiles\profilename.default

    so for me that is

    C:\Users\Chris\AppData\Roaming\8pecxstudios\Cyberfox\Profiles\ggla2kpt.default

    Nothing to do with the Program folder here:

    C:\Program Files\Cyberfox

    After an upgrade or fresh install C:\Program Files\Cyberfox should be overwritten with new files automatically.

    The backup/ restore should only affect your profile (in AppData)

    So normally you should always keep your backup in a location way from AppData or Program Files and store it somewhere else.

    The program folder contained of course the Cyberfox itself.
    I know that the profile is hidden under Roaming.
    The language-pack is inside the Roaming Profile folder.
    But the language-pack corrupted the whole program.
    I had to paste the program folder back in order to restart Cyberfox 46
    Afterwards I had to delete the Dutch language pack and install the right one. (after updating to 47)
    The problem is that the language-pack of Mozilla is incompatible with the Cyberfox 47 version.
    So there are two versions. The language manager lead me first to the wrong pack.
    After installing version 47 I again loaded the language-manager with led me to another download.
    Only the 8pecxstudios.com version should be used.
